Aluminum shafts are strong and stiff but comparatively heavy. Aluminum also conducts cold, which is a major consideration if you paddle where the air or water temperatures are below 60 degrees. Fiberglass shafts are reasonably stiff, strong, and light — and are the most common.Carbon and fiberglass shafts are durable, strong and lightweight. Pairing one of those shaft materials with either of those lightweight composite blade materials creates your most lightweight and efficient paddle option—and the price will reflect that level of performance.Fiberglass shafts are reasonably stiff, strong, and light — and are the most common. Carbon shafts are extremely stiff and light, resulting in more efficient stroke, and for this reason are preferred by those who race or paddle long distances.

It will have denser drop stitching, less layers of pvc, be heat bonded rather than glued.Why Is Paddle Board Thickness Important? An inflatable SUP needs to have a certain amount of thickness to ensure that it has enough rigidity and stability to support a rider’s weight on the water. However, if the board is too thick, then riders will have trouble feeling “connected” to the water.The most popular SUP boards for general use are 10-11 feet in length and between 32 and 34 inches wide. If stability is a high priority for you, you’ll want to look for a board that is 33-34 inches wide. You can go wider, but you may end up with a board that is sluggish and less fun to paddle.
